Outplacement services have become increasingly popular in recent years as companies recognize the benefits they offer to both employees and employers These services provide support and guidance to employees who are transitioning out of a company due to downsizing, restructuring, or other reasons While outplacement services may initially seem like an additional cost to a company, the long-term benefits far outweigh the initial investment.

One of the key advantages of outplacement services is the positive impact they have on the employees who are affected by a layoff or termination Losing a job can be a traumatic experience, causing stress, anxiety, and uncertainty about the future Outplacement services provide employees with valuable resources to help them navigate this difficult period This can include career counseling, resume writing assistance, job search support, interview coaching, and networking opportunities.

By offering outplacement services, companies show their commitment to supporting their employees through a challenging time This can help to boost employee morale and engagement, even among those who are not directly affected by the layoffs Employees are more likely to view the company in a positive light and feel that their employer cares about their well-being, which can improve retention rates and employee loyalty.

Outplacement services can also help companies to save money in the long run While there may be a cost associated with providing outplacement services, the return on investment can be significant Employees who receive outplacement support are more likely to find new employment quickly and smoothly, reducing the financial burden on the company in terms of severance pay and unemployment benefits Additionally, employees who feel supported during a layoff are more likely to speak positively about their former employer, which can help to attract top talent in the future.

From an employer’s perspective, outplacement services can also help to reduce the risk of legal action following a layoff Employees who feel that they have been treated unfairly during a termination process are more likely to file lawsuits against their former employer By offering outplacement services, companies can demonstrate that they are acting in good faith and treating employees with compassion and professionalism This can help to reduce the likelihood of expensive and time-consuming legal battles.
